For those of you who have had a chance to watch it already, Steven Moffat the co-creator of the series and current show runner for the most recent Doctor Who, revealed some tidbits of what was to occur during a recent interview with NPR’s Morning Edition.
Asked about hints for Sherlock season 2, Moffat dropped the following enigmatic answer:
“The critical words, I’d say, would be: Adler, Hound, Reichenbach.”
